Community Language Learning

Community Language Learning (CLL) is an approach to language teaching where learners, guided by a teacher acting as a counselor, collaborate to express their thoughts in the new language. The process encourages active participation, listening, and dialogue, creating a supportive environment that respects learners’ needs and feelings. CLL emphasizes communication over rote memorization, fostering confidence through group interaction and reflection. It draws from counseling techniques to help learners resolve language difficulties collectively, making learning more natural and meaningful. Overall, CLL promotes a community-oriented, learner-centered method that prioritizes real-life communication skills.
